Webb28 nov. 2024 · With shoulder instability, the supporting structures around the joint, including the tendons and ligaments, become loose or stretched, allowing the ball joint to move too loosely in its socket. If you feel like your shoulder may slip out of joint when swinging a baseball bat, you may simply have lax supporting structures.

WebbTraumatic UCL Injuries. The ulnar collateral ligament may also be injured if you fall on your outstretched arm. In this case, the UCL may rupture or get pulled off the humerus, chipping a small piece of bone. This is called an avulsion fracture, and it’s rare.
